Beginning Bonsai with Rebecca Ayres

ON-SITE | Saturday, October 19 | 9:30am - 4:30pm

-------------------------------------------

Although it has its roots in ancient Asian traditions, the living art of bonsai now enjoys enthusiasts throughout much of the world. This class will provide the basic concepts and skills for novices to begin growing and shaping their own miniature trees. The first half of the class will cover the fundamental horticultural and aesthetic principles of bonsai. It will include such topics as tree selection, watering, pest control, pruning, wiring, and styling. In the second half of the class, each participant will receive a pot, scissors, wire, and planting medium. With guidance from the instructor, the students will create their own bonsai to take home. Materials included in registration.


Rebecca Ayres is a ceramic artist and gardener. A longtime Arboretum volunteer, she is the assistant to the bonsai curator and helps with overseeing the exhibition garden, the collection and the Carolina Bonsai Expo. She is a member of the Blue Ridge Bonsai Society, where she has taught workshops and classes, and is a graduate of the Arboretum's Blue Ridge Naturalist program.
